STEVANDIĆ: REPUBLIKA SRPSKA REMAINS PERMANENT WITH ITS CONSTITUTION AND INSTITUTIONS

BANJA LUKA, FEBRUARY 28 /SRNA/ – The Speaker of the National Assembly of Republika Srpska, Nenad Stevandić, told SRNA that 34 years after the adoption of the first Constitution of Republika Srpska testify to its statehood, emphasizing that Republika Srpska remains permanent and indisputable with its institutions.

"Only state-forming nations mark the anniversaries of their constitutions, statehood days and assembly days. The marking of 35 years of the National Assembly and 34 years of the Constitution testifies to the statehood and centuries-long presence of our people in these areas," Stevandić said. He stated that Republika Srpska has lasted much longer than the Kingdom of Yugoslavia and many other entities that had a temporary character. "Only those republics founded on the will of the people have a lasting character, and the will of the Serb people has been defined for 35 years through the Constitution, the National Assembly, and the functioning of Republika Srpska despite all challenges, threats, and attempts at obstruction," Stevandić pointed out. He stressed that Republika Srpska remains permanent and inviolable with its institutions and Constitution. The Assembly of the Serb People of BiH adopted the Constitution on February 28, 1992, which was unanimously adopted on the foundations of the founding Declaration and guaranteed full equality and equal rights of the peoples and citizens of the Republic. The highest legal act of Republika Srpska, which remains in force today with certain amendments, was adopted before the outbreak of the tragic conflicts and the unilateral declaration of BiH independence by Bosniaks and Croats following the referendum held on March 1, in which Serbs did not participate.
